Soon after they married, Mr. and Mrs. Nichols pioneered to Tioga, in north-central Texas, where this lovely dress must have been a treasured heirloom. Granddaughter Nonic Louise Nich- ols chose to wear it to marry Leigh Brown on September s, 1891.
